Home
last modified time | relevance | path

Searched refs:sockaddr_pn (Results 1 – 7 of 7) sorted by relevance

/linux-4.4.14/include/uapi/linux/
Dphonet.h101 struct sockaddr_pn { struct
137 static inline void pn_sockaddr_set_addr(struct sockaddr_pn *spn, __u8 addr) in pn_sockaddr_set_addr()
143 static inline void pn_sockaddr_set_port(struct sockaddr_pn *spn, __u16 port) in pn_sockaddr_set_port()
150 static inline void pn_sockaddr_set_object(struct sockaddr_pn *spn, in pn_sockaddr_set_object()
157 static inline void pn_sockaddr_set_resource(struct sockaddr_pn *spn, in pn_sockaddr_set_resource()
163 static inline __u8 pn_sockaddr_get_addr(const struct sockaddr_pn *spn) in pn_sockaddr_get_addr()
168 static inline __u16 pn_sockaddr_get_port(const struct sockaddr_pn *spn) in pn_sockaddr_get_port()
173 static inline __u16 pn_sockaddr_get_object(const struct sockaddr_pn *spn) in pn_sockaddr_get_object()
178 static inline __u8 pn_sockaddr_get_resource(const struct sockaddr_pn *spn) in pn_sockaddr_get_resource()
/linux-4.4.14/include/net/phonet/
Dphonet.h51 struct sock *pn_find_sock_by_sa(struct net *net, const struct sockaddr_pn *sa);
64 const struct sockaddr_pn *target);
81 void pn_skb_get_src_sockaddr(struct sk_buff *skb, struct sockaddr_pn *sa) in pn_skb_get_src_sockaddr()
93 void pn_skb_get_dst_sockaddr(struct sk_buff *skb, struct sockaddr_pn *sa) in pn_skb_get_dst_sockaddr()
/linux-4.4.14/net/phonet/
Dsocket.c77 struct sock *pn_find_sock_by_sa(struct net *net, const struct sockaddr_pn *spn) in pn_find_sock_by_sa()
169 struct sockaddr_pn *spn = (struct sockaddr_pn *)addr; in pn_socket_bind()
177 if (len < sizeof(struct sockaddr_pn)) in pn_socket_bind()
182 handle = pn_sockaddr_get_object((struct sockaddr_pn *)addr); in pn_socket_bind()
213 struct sockaddr_pn sa; in pn_socket_autobind()
219 sizeof(struct sockaddr_pn)); in pn_socket_autobind()
231 struct sockaddr_pn *spn = (struct sockaddr_pn *)addr; in pn_socket_connect()
238 if (len < sizeof(struct sockaddr_pn)) in pn_socket_connect()
330 memset(addr, 0, sizeof(struct sockaddr_pn)); in pn_socket_getname()
333 pn_sockaddr_set_object((struct sockaddr_pn *)addr, in pn_socket_getname()
[all …]
Ddatagram.c88 DECLARE_SOCKADDR(struct sockaddr_pn *, target, msg->msg_name); in pn_sendmsg()
99 if (msg->msg_namelen < sizeof(struct sockaddr_pn)) in pn_sendmsg()
131 struct sockaddr_pn sa; in pn_recvmsg()
Dpep.c103 struct sockaddr_pn peer; in pep_reply()
208 struct sockaddr_pn dst; in pep_ctrlreq_error()
638 const struct sockaddr_pn *dst, in pep_find_pipe()
671 struct sockaddr_pn dst; in pep_do_rcv()
780 struct sockaddr_pn dst, src; in pep_sock_accept()
Daf_phonet.c238 const struct sockaddr_pn *target) in pn_skb_send()
377 struct sockaddr_pn sa; in phonet_rcv()
/linux-4.4.14/Documentation/networking/
Dphonet.txt77 struct sockaddr_pn {
97 struct sockaddr_pn addr = { .spn_family = AF_PHONET, };